Eligibility Check for 36000 Through BISP 8171
Before registering for the Ehsaas Program, it is important to determine whether you meet the eligibility criteria.
- The program primarily targets vulnerable segments of society, including low-income households and individuals facing economic hardships.
- To check your eligibility, you can visit the official Ehsaas Program website or SEND CNIC to 8171 and provide the required information, such as income, family size, and other relevant details.
- The online system will evaluate your eligibility based on the provided information.
Registration Process for New Applicants
For those who meet the eligibility criteria, the registration process for the Ehsaas Program is straightforward. Follow these steps to register for new enrollment:
- Visit the official Ehsaas Program website.
- Locate the registration section or portal.
- Provide accurate personal information, including name, CNIC (Computerized National Identity Card) number, contact details, and address.
- Submit the required supporting documents, such as income certificates or proof of financial hardship.
- Review the provided information for accuracy and submit the registration form.
